在Debian 9上安装和配置V2Ray的完整指南

介绍

在现代网络环境中,使用代理工具如V2Ray能够有效提升网络的隐私和安全性。本文将介绍如何在Debian 9上安装和配置V2Ray,让你能更便捷地访问网络资源。

V2Ray是什么?

V2Ray是一个功能强大的网络代理工具,它支持多种协议和传输方式,是一种被广泛使用的翻墙软件。其设计目的是为了提供更高的安全性和更好的隐私保护,适合需要突破网络限制的用户。

Debian 9系统准备

在开始安装V2Ray之前,需要确保你的Debian 9系统已经更新并且安装了必需的工具。可以通过以下命令更新系统:

bash sudo apt update && sudo apt upgrade -y

安装curl工具

在安装V2Ray之前,确保你的系统中安装了curl工具。可以使用以下命令安装:

bash sudo apt install curl -y

V2Ray的安装步骤

步骤一:下载V2Ray

使用以下命令下载V2Ray安装脚本:

bash bash <(curl -L -s https://install.direct/go.sh)

这个命令会自动下载并安装V2Ray的最新版本。

步骤二:验证安装

安装完成后,可以通过以下命令检查V2Ray是否安装成功:

bash v2ray -version

如果返回版本信息,则说明安装成功。

配置V2Ray

安装完成后,需要对V2Ray进行配置以适应个人的使用需求。配置文件通常位于 /etc/v2ray/config.json

步骤一:备份原配置

在修改配置文件之前,建议备份原始配置文件:

bash sudo cp /etc/v2ray/config.json /etc/v2ray/config.json.bak

步骤二:编辑配置文件

使用你喜欢的文本编辑器打开配置文件:

bash sudo nano /etc/v2ray/config.json

在配置文件中,可以根据需要修改以下几部分:

  • outbounds: 这里可以配置V2Ray的出口代理。
  • inbounds: 这里可以设置本地代理的端口。
  • transport: 可以配置传输方式,如TCP或WebSocket。

步骤三:启动V2Ray服务

配置完成后,可以启动V2Ray服务:

bash sudo systemctl start v2ray

同时可以设置开机自启:

bash sudo systemctl enable v2ray

常见问题解答

V2Ray需要哪些依赖?

V2RayDebian 9上运行需要的依赖较少,主要是curlsystemd

V2Ray配置文件的基本格式是怎样的?

V2Ray的配置文件为JSON格式,通常包含inboundsoutbounds字段,具体配置根据个人需求而定。

如何检查V2Ray的运行状态?

可以使用以下命令检查V2Ray的状态:

bash sudo systemctl status v2ray

如何更新V2Ray?

更新V2Ray可以再次执行安装命令,它会自动下载并覆盖旧版本:

bash bash <(curl -L -s https://install.direct/go.sh)

总结

通过本文的介绍,你应该能够在Debian 9上顺利安装并配置V2Ray。无论是用于翻墙还是提升网络安全,V2Ray都提供了灵活而强大的解决方案。希望本文能帮助到你,如有更多问题,可以随时查阅官方文档或寻求社区支持。

正文完